PAGE 3 Endeavors Ensuring the Safety of Our Brothers Spring 2021 Fire Drill Keeps Safety at the Forefront I magine sleeping through an ear-splitting fire alarm while a kitchen fire rages for nine minutes before firemen show up in your dorm room to rescue you. That's what happened at a sorority a few houses away from Theta Chi recently, where three young women slept through a real fire alarm. Theta Chi brothers take fire safety seriously, so even without that stark example of the need for vigilance, another drill was conducted by the Des Moines Fire Department (DMFD) under the guidance of sophomore Bryan Schlotterbeck '23 in early April. Bryan, as the health and safety director for the spring and fall semesters, arranged details of the drill with Drake Safety, Midwest Alarm, Midwest Sprinkler Systems, and the DMFD. He also ensured a roster of live-in names and room locations was provided to the lieutenant on scene and checked that members gathered at the correct location for a head count. Many of the participants had never seen the correct way to use a fire extinguisher, so that training was especially beneficial during the exercise. Also in attendance was OXBC board member Al Kopec '79. While the drill was a great learning experience, we managed to have some fun, too. Tom Wrigley '21 and Evan Del Carmen '22 had the honor of pulling the fire alarm; what child doesn't dream of doing that?
